Explain biomaterial implantation
When a biomaterial is introduced into the host, in addition to a host response there is also a material response. Immediately on implantation, there is an adsorption of proteins. These proteins come from the blood and tissue fluids at the wound site and later from cellular activity in the interfacial region. Once on the surface, the proteins (undenatured or denatured, intact or fragmented) can desorb or remain to mediate tissue implant interactions.
